That is why this article tells the story of the man who, before any technology company existed, had already imagined the future we are building.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">In this text you will learn about Alan Turing&#8217;s trajectory, his main inventions and concepts, his decisive role in World War II, his contribution to the birth of artificial intelligence, and the legacy that remains alive in every line of code written in the world today.<\/p>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-4644\" src=\"https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1.avif\" alt=\"Portrait of Alan Turing, British mathematician considered the father of modern computing and artificial intelligence\" width=\"1200\" height=\"800\" srcset=\"https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1.avif 1200w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1-300x200.avif 300w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1-1024x683.avif 1024w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1-768x512.avif 768w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1-150x100.avif 150w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1-330x220.avif 330w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1-420x280.avif 420w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Alan-Turing-1-510x340.avif 510w\" sizes=\"auto, (max-width: 1200px) 100vw, 1200px\" \/><\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\">Who Was Alan Turing?<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Alan Mathison Turing was born on June 23, 1912, in Westminster, London, England. From childhood, he demonstrated an extraordinary aptitude for mathematics and logic, with an intelligence clearly recognized by his own teachers. By the age of 13, he already showed a singular talent for numbers and exact sciences.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">He studied at Sherborne School and later entered King&#8217;s College, Cambridge, where he graduated in Mathematics in 1934. The following year, he was elected a Fellow of the university for his dissertation on Bernoulli numbers (a sequence with great importance in number theory). In 1938, he earned his doctorate in Mathematics from Princeton University in the United States, where he was supervised by mathematician Alonzo Church.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">It was during his years at Cambridge that Turing began to formulate the ideas that would change the world. Fascinated by mathematical logic and the nature of computation, he questioned the limits of what machines could do, and whether there were mathematical problems no machine would ever be able to solve. That question led him to create, in 1936, the most important concept of his career: the Turing Machine.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">According to the Encyclopaedia Britannica, all modern computers are, in essence, a product of the technological advancement driven by Turing. (Source: <a class=\"underline underline underline-offset-2 decoration-1 decoration-current\/40 hover:decoration-current focus:decoration-current\" href=\"https:\/\/www.britannica.com\/biography\/Alan-Turing\" target=\"_blank\" rel=\"noopener\">Encyclopaedia Britannica \u2014 Alan Turing<\/a>)<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\">What Is the Turing Machine?<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">In 1936, Turing published the seminal paper &#8220;On Computable Numbers, with an Application to the Entscheidungsproblem&#8221; in the Proceedings of the London Mathematical Society. In that work, he introduced the concept that became known as the Turing Machine.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">The Turing Machine is not a physical machine: it is a theoretical model. It describes a hypothetical device capable of reading, writing, and manipulating symbols on a tape according to a set of predefined rules. Through these simple operations, the device would be capable of simulating any computational process that could be described by an algorithm.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">This may sound abstract, but it has an enormous practical consequence: Turing proved that a single device, following the right instructions, could solve any computable problem. That is the foundation of the general-purpose computer; the same principle that allows your laptop to run a text editor, a browser, an engineering application, and an AI model, all on the same machine.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Another direct legacy of this model is the conceptual separation between software (the logical instructions) and hardware (the physical structure that executes them). This distinction, which today seems obvious, was formalized by Turing decades before any commercial computer existed. The software we write today is a direct descendant of the Turing Machine.<\/p>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-4645\" src=\"https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1.avif\" alt=\"Technician operating one of the first large-scale computers, representing the technological context of Alan Turing's era and the development of modern computing\" width=\"1200\" height=\"800\" srcset=\"https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1.avif 1200w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1-300x200.avif 300w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1-1024x683.avif 1024w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1-768x512.avif 768w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1-150x100.avif 150w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1-330x220.avif 330w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1-420x280.avif 420w, https:\/\/nextage.com.br\/blog\/wp-content\/uploads\/2026\/06\/Teste-de-turing-1-510x340.avif 510w\" sizes=\"auto, (max-width: 1200px) 100vw, 1200px\" \/><\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\">Alan Turing and World War II: How He Shortened the Conflict<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">The work of Turing that had the greatest short-term impact on the world was not theoretical: it was practical, urgent, and secret.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">During World War II (1939\u20131945), Nazi Germany used a sophisticated cryptography system to transmit military orders without enemies being able to intercept them. The machine behind this system was called Enigma, developed by German engineer Arthur Scherbius. It created encrypted messages through rotors that generated millions of possible combinations, and the settings changed every 24 hours, making manual decryption practically impossible.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">As soon as Britain entered the war, Turing was recruited to work at the Government Code and Cypher School, at the secret center of Bletchley Park. There, he led a team of mathematicians, cryptographers, and linguists with a single objective: break the Enigma.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Turing drew inspiration from an earlier machine, the Polish Bombe (created by mathematician Marian Rejewski), and developed a significantly more efficient British version. Turing&#8217;s Bombe was an electromechanical device capable of automatically testing Enigma code settings at high speed, reducing the search space to a manageable set that could be verified manually. More than 200 of these machines were built by the British during the war.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">The result was decisive. With the ability to read enemy communications, the Allies were able to anticipate naval movements, prevent attacks, and plan operations with privileged information, including D-Day, the Normandy invasion in June 1944, which marked the beginning of the collapse of the Third Reich.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Historians estimate that the work of Turing and his team at Bletchley Park shortened the war by at least two years and saved millions of lives. (Sources: <a class=\"underline underline underline-offset-2 decoration-1 decoration-current\/40 hover:decoration-current focus:decoration-current\" href=\"https:\/\/medium.com\/turing-talks\/alan-turing-o-homem-que-mudou-a-hist%C3%B3ria-d0547822d264\" target=\"_blank\" rel=\"noopener\">Medium \u2014 Turing Talks<\/a>; <a class=\"underline underline underline-offset-2 decoration-1 decoration-current\/40 hover:decoration-current focus:decoration-current\" href=\"https:\/\/drytelecom.com.br\/artigo\/o-arquiteto-do-pensamento-digital-alan-turing-a-quebra-do-enigma-e-a-origem-da-criptografia-moderna\">Dry Telecom \u2014 The Architect of Digital Thought<\/a>)<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">For decades, all of this work remained an absolute secret, protected by the British Official Secrets Act. Documents about Bletchley Park only began to be revealed to the public in the 1970s, which means Turing received no public recognition during his lifetime for what he did in the war.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\">Alan Turing and Artificial Intelligence: The Question That Changed Everything<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">After the war, Turing turned his attention to a question that had accompanied him for years: could machines think?<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">In 1950, he published the paper &#8220;Computing Machinery and Intelligence&#8221; in the philosophical journal Mind. The opening question was direct: &#8220;Can machines think?&#8221; Turing argued that this question was poorly formulated, because &#8220;thinking&#8221; was difficult to define. Instead, he proposed a practical experiment to evaluate whether a machine exhibited intelligent behavior: what he called the &#8220;imitation game,&#8221; later known as the Turing Test.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">The test works as follows: a human evaluator interacts via text with two entities, a machine and a human, without knowing which is which. If the evaluator cannot consistently distinguish the machine from the human, the machine is considered capable of exhibiting intelligent behavior.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">The elegance of the Turing Test lies in its practicality: it does not ask &#8220;what is intelligence?&#8221; (a philosophical question with no definitive answer), but rather &#8220;is this machine&#8217;s behavior indistinguishable from human behavior?&#8221; (an empirical, testable question). This methodological shift was the starting point for all artificial intelligence research that followed.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Turing was also one of the first scientists in the world to seriously consider the possibility of machines learning, the precursor of what we today call machine learning. According to Nature magazine, he was one of the first people to think of computers as a system capable of responding to any type of problem. The question Turing asked in 1950, &#8220;is this machine&#8217;s behavior indistinguishable from a human&#8217;s?&#8221;, remains one of the most relevant for anyone working with AI applied to business.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\">Other Contributions by Alan Turing<\/h2>\n<h3 class=\"text-text-100 mt-2 -mb-1 text-base font-bold\">The Church-Turing Thesis<\/h3>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">In collaboration with his doctoral supervisor, mathematician Alonzo Church, Turing formulated what became known as the Church-Turing Thesis. It postulates that any computable function can be executed by a Universal Turing Machine. In practical terms, this means that every problem that can be solved algorithmically can, in principle, be solved by a computer. This principle is the theoretical foundation of all modern computer science. (Source: <a class=\"underline underline underline-offset-2 decoration-1 decoration-current\/40 hover:decoration-current focus:decoration-current\" href=\"https:\/\/hes.pt\/blog\/tecnologia\/alan-turing\" target=\"_blank\" rel=\"noopener\">HES Blog \u2014 Alan Turing: The Father of Modern Computing<\/a>)<\/p>\n<h3 class=\"text-text-100 mt-2 -mb-1 text-base font-bold\">The ACE: One of the First Digital Computer Designs<\/h3>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">After the war, Turing worked at the National Physical Laboratory and developed the design for the ACE (Automatic Computing Engine), one of the first detailed blueprints for a digital computer with programs stored in memory. He later moved to the University of Manchester, where he continued research in computer design and even created one of the first chess programs for a computer.<\/p>\n<h3 class=\"text-text-100 mt-2 -mb-1 text-base font-bold\">Mathematical Biology<\/h3>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">In 1952, Turing published &#8220;The Chemical Basis of Morphogenesis,&#8221; proposing a mathematical model to explain how complex patterns (such as zebra stripes or leopard spots) form from simple chemical reactions. This work is considered one of the foundations of mathematical biology and complex systems, fields that today influence everything from epidemic modeling to ecosystem simulation.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\">The Tragic End of a Genius and His Belated Rehabilitation<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Turing&#8217;s life ended in a profoundly unjust way.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">In 1952, he was prosecuted by the British government for &#8220;gross indecency&#8221; after admitting to a homosexual relationship, conduct criminalized in England at the time. As an alternative to imprisonment, he was subjected to chemical castration, a hormonal treatment that caused him serious physical and psychological consequences. He also lost his security clearance and was barred from continuing to work for the government.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Alan Turing died on June 8, 1954, at the age of 41, from cyanide poisoning. The cause was presumed to be suicide, although some historians have raised the possibility of an accident.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Public recognition for his role in the war and in science took decades. In 2009, British Prime Minister Gordon Brown issued a formal public apology for the treatment Turing received. In 2013, Queen Elizabeth II granted him an official posthumous pardon. And on June 23, 2021 (his birthday), the Bank of England placed his portrait on the \u00a350 note, making him the only scientist to appear on a British banknote.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">In a BBC poll conducted in 2019 to elect the greatest scientist of the 20th century, Alan Turing was chosen as the winner by the public.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\">Alan Turing&#8217;s Legacy: From Algorithm to Generative AI<\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Turing&#8217;s legacy is diffuse in the best possible sense: it is everywhere, invisible and omnipresent.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Every time a developer writes a function, an algorithm, or a conditional loop, they are operating within the conceptual framework that Turing formalized.
